What is a radical? It’s the question of M.I.A.’s vexing career

M.I.A. performs at the Germania Insurance Amphitheater in Austin, Texas, on May 1. A day later, in Dallas, she gave a performance that got her fired from her tour with Kid Cudi.

Fans who danced to “Paper Planes” might hardly recognize the conspiracy-touting artist before them today — but in a certain way, she’s the same button-pusher as ever.
